About WITNEY AND DISTRICT YOUNG FARMERS' CLUB

WITNEY AND DISTRICT YOUNG FARMERS' CLUB is a registered charity in England and Wales (registration number 308032). Based on official Charity Commission data, it holds a "Good Standing" rating with a CharityScore of 68/100 — a charity in good standing with solid but not exceptional governance indicators. This reflects adequate performance across most criteria, though some areas fall short of the strongest-rated charities. In its most recent reporting year (2015), WITNEY AND DISTRICT YOUNG FARMERS' CLUB reported a total income of £3,396 and total expenditure of £5,731, a spending ratio of 169% indicating a strong proportion of funds directed to charitable work. According to the Charity Commission register, WITNEY AND DISTRICT YOUNG FARMERS' CLUB describes its activities as follows: Countryside based activities and competitions.
